
C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E
For the sake of good appearance and reliability, keep the appliance clean. The modern design of the unit
facilitates the maintenance to the minimum. The parts of the appliance that come into contact with food
have to be cleaned regularly.
• Prior to any maintenance or cleaning, disconnect the power cord from the mains or switch off the circuit
breaker of the appliance mains outlet.
• Wait until the inside of the appliance is no longer hot but is still lukewarm – cleaning is easier than when it
is cold.
• Clean the outer surface of the appliance with a damp cloth, soft brush or light sponge and then wipe it dry.
• The bottom and ceiling of the appliance can be wiped with a damp cloth, soft brush or sponge. In the case
of heavy dirt, use hot water with a non-aggressive detergent.
• Do not use coarse abrasive cleaners or sharp metal scrapers to clean the door glass of the appliance, since
they can scratch the glass surface or the glass may break.
• Never leave aggressive or acidic substances (lemon juice, vinegar) on the enamelled, varnished or stainless
parts.
• Do not use a steam cleaner to clean the appliance!
• The baking pans may be washed in a dishwasher.
APPLIANCE INSTALLATION
•
Do not lift the appliance by holding it by
the handle of the door!
•
Defects caused by incorrect installation
are not covered by the warranty.
• Only the customer, not the manufacturer, is
responsible for the appliance installation.
• The manufacturer bears no responsibility
for damage caused to people, animals or
objects as a result of incorrect installation.
• To ensure correct function of the appliance,
install it in suitable furniture.
• The unit should be installed in standardi-
sed kitchen furniture designed for built-in
appliances or in properly adapted furniture
of dimensions according to Fig. 5.
• The appliance may be located either under
a kitchen cabinet or in a stand-alone cabi-
net (Fig. 5).
• The kitchen furniture must be made of
heat-resistant material (at least 120 °C). The materials and used glues must be resistant to the warming of
the unit according to the ČSN EN 60335-2-6 standard. Materials and glues which do not meet the stated
standard may deform or come unstuck.
• All the protective covers must be fixed at their positions so that it is not possible to remove them without
using a special tool.
• The rear board of the kitchen unit must be removed to ensure proper circulation of air around the
appliance.
• If a cook top is above the appliance, a gap of at least 50 mm must be between them.
